How they compare
Japan currently reports 1.66 GPIA against 1.62 GPIA in Saint Lucia, a difference of 0.04 GPIA.
Across all 10 years both countries report, Japan has been ahead every year.
Japan ranks 5th and Saint Lucia ranks 6th of 120 countries.
Japan has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
